Output e3629bcc8736a1fac7db2c4f703d0961896ce36c95774188b76396fdfa66f047:8

value
33046821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059755741078531129f28f8e5166962a9e6ba9bd OP_EQUAL
address
32CabMphfcUJ1v4kDN3H4yuZBTaDf1i3qc
transaction
e3629bcc8736a1fac7db2c4f703d0961896ce36c95774188b76396fdfa66f047
spent
true